Setting Up Your Revolut Account – The First Steps
Before you even think about a casino Revolut deposit, you need a fully verified Revolut account. Download the app from the App Store or Google Play, register with your email and phone number, then follow the on‑screen prompts to link a Canadian bank account or a debit card. The verification process usually asks for a government‑issued ID and a selfie – this is the KYC (Know Your Customer) step that protects you from fraud.
Once verification is complete, add funds to your Revolut balance. You can do this by a direct bank transfer, an Interac e‑Transfer, or by linking a debit card. Keep an eye on the app’s “top‑up limits” – most users can add up to CAD 10,000 per month, more than enough for regular casino play. After the balance is topped up, you’re ready to head to a licensed Canadian casino that lists Revolut as a deposit option.
Making Your First Casino Deposit with Revolut
The actual deposit process varies a little between casinos, but the core steps are the same. Log into your casino account, navigate to the “Cashier” or “Deposit” page, and select Revolut from the list of payment methods. You’ll be asked to enter the amount you wish to deposit – most sites allow a minimum of CAD 10 and a maximum that can go up to CAD 5,000 per transaction.
After confirming the amount, a secure pop‑up window will appear, prompting you to log into your Revolut app to authorise the payment. This two‑factor step (your PIN or fingerprint) ensures that only you can approve the transfer. Once approved, the casino’s balance updates instantly and you can start playing or claim any welcome bonus that is tied to Revolut deposits.

Managing Withdrawals and Funds Security
When it comes time to withdraw winnings, the process mirrors the deposit flow but with a few extra checks. Most licensed Canadian casinos require you to verify your identity (KYC) before the first withdrawal – this usually means uploading a copy of your driver’s licence and a recent utility bill.
After verification, select Revolut as the withdrawal method. The speed of payouts varies: some operators promise “instant payouts” that land in your Revolut app within 15‑30 minutes, while others process withdrawals within 24‑48 hours. Always check the casino’s withdrawal policy for any minimum amount – many require at least CAD 20 before you can pull funds to Revolut.
Common Issues & Troubleshooting Tips
If a deposit doesn’t go through, the first thing to verify is that your Revolut balance has enough funds and that you haven’t hit the daily deposit limit set by the casino. Some platforms also block deposits from prepaid cards, so ensure your Revolut account is fully topped up rather than relying on a linked debit card with a low balance.
Another frequent hiccup is a mismatch between the currency displayed by the casino (often USD) and your Revolut account (CAD). Revolut automatically converts at the interbank rate, but the casino may apply a small conversion fee. To avoid surprise fees, look for a “CAD‑only” casino or enable the “local currency” option in your Revolut settings.

Responsible Gambling and Safe Play with Revolut
Revolut includes built‑in spending limits that can help you stay within your budget. Set a daily or monthly limit directly in the app, and once you hit it, the app will block further transactions – even if you try to deposit at a casino. This feature works alongside the casino’s own responsible‑gambling tools, such as self‑exclusion and loss‑limit settings.
Remember that g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of income. If you feel you’re chasing losses, use the “Cool‑Off” feature in Revolut to temporarily freeze your account, and contact the casino’s responsible‑gaming support team. Many Canadian operators are members of the Responsible Gambling Council and provide 24/7 chat support for players needing assistance.
